        Oh, yes, one more thing. The 360, 380, and 373-marked insignia are all widely recognized as fakes from the same period. However, they are of even higher quality materials and manufacture than the 475/43 insignia you like so much and I doubt that I or anyone could prove to your satisfaction that they are fakes. So, I am guesing that you will be buying up all of those you can find too...or have you already?
